DraftKings launches in the UK

SBC News DraftKings launches in the UK

It has been announced today that major DFS operator DraftKings has launched in the UK. This long awaited launch, which was originally scheduled for October 2015, follows the announcement of three Premier League clubs as partners earlier this week. Deals were agreed with Arsenal, Watford and Liverpool which will ensure the operator has exposure at these clubs and will be …

Betsson pays backdated taxes to German authorities 

SBC News Betsson pays backdated taxes to German authorities 

Stating its intent to join a future regulated German sports betting market, Malta licensed European operator Betsson Plc has declared that it will pay historic taxes of circa SEK 113 million (£9 million) to the German government. Issuing a corporate statement declaring its goodwill intent, Betsson governance stated “Betsson still believes that it is not subject to a tax liability, but …
